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94 995 48
99415 62 30327784759
99415 62 30327784759
227412 80 63642 041 1284
All about undefined
Interested in learning more?
99415 62 30327784759
227412 80 63642 041 1284
See more
218 5451533 1960
330000289 41959 058 3050
See more
615 193
7555820241 54908069197 86680586
See more